What is Barzakh?

According to the Islamic holy book Quran, Barzakh is understood as a veil or "curtain" that lies between two entities, preventing them from interacting with one another. In the context of life's different phases, Barzakh refers to the state of existence between this worldly life and the Hereafter—a "curtain" that Allah has placed between these two realms. 

The Quran, the holy book of Islam, alludes to the Barzakh several times. While not explicitly defined, verses such as those in Surah Al-Mu'minun (23:99-100) suggest a period of waiting after death: "Do they not see that We have created the night for rest and the day for activity? Verily, in this are signs for people who believe. And there is a barrier between them and the Barzakh. And they will not be sent out from it until they are resurrected."

The concept of Barzakh is often depicted as a place of reckoning, where souls contemplate their actions on Earth. It's neither the harshness of Hell nor the bliss of Paradise but a state of anticipation. However, the exact nature of Barzakh remains a subject of interpretation and debate among Islamic scholars.

This concept is explicitly mentioned in the Holy Qur'an, where it states, "Before them is a barrier (Barzakh) until the Day they are raised" (23:100). This verse clearly indicates that life continues after death, but before the Day of Judgment."

Barzakh: The Allegorical World

The period of Barzakh is referred to as the Allegorical World because, while it resembles our present world in shape and form, it is different in substance and matter. As per the Holy Quran and religious scholars, in this phase, our bodies will also be allegorical (Misaali), meaning they will physically appear similar to how they do in this world but will exist independently of matter. These allegorical bodies are described as being transparent, more pleasant, and lighter than air, unencumbered by the barriers that limit us in the material world.

About Barzakh Series

'Barzakh' is a 2024 Pakistani fantasy drama television series directed and written by Asim Abbasi. The series features Fawad Khan, Sanam Saeed, M Fawad Khan and Salman Shahid in the lead roles. Consisting of six episodes, the series premiered on July 19, 2024. It is produced by Waqas Hassan and Shailja Kejriwal for Zindagi, the Indian subcontinent-focused programming block on the streaming platform ZEE5 Global.
